automated parking systems, also known as robotic or mechanical parking systems, are structures designed to automatically park and retrieve vehicles without the need for human intervention. These systems utilize a combination of sensors, cameras, lifts, conveyors, and computer algorithms to safely and efficiently store vehicles in designated parking spaces. The process begins when a driver pulls into the entrance of the automated parking facility and leaves their vehicle in a designated area. The system then takes over, lifting the vehicle and transporting it to an available parking space within the structure. When the driver is ready to retrieve their vehicle, they simply input a code or swipe a card at a kiosk, and the system retrieves their vehicle and brings it back to the entrance for them to drive away.

One of the key benefits of automated parking systems is their ability to maximize the use of available space. Unlike traditional parking garages where vehicles are parked in rows and columns, automated parking systems utilize vertical and horizontal space more efficiently by stacking vehicles on top of each other and moving them around with mechanical precision. This allows for a higher density of parking spaces within a smaller footprint, making automated parking systems ideal for urban areas where space is at a premium.

In addition to space efficiency, automated parking systems also offer enhanced security for parked vehicles. By eliminating the need for human drivers to navigate through tight parking spaces, the risk of accidents and damage to vehicles is significantly reduced. Furthermore, automated parking systems are equipped with surveillance cameras and motion sensors to monitor the facility and ensure the safety of vehicles at all times. This added level of security can provide peace of mind for drivers who are concerned about the safety of their vehicles in traditional parking garages.

Another major advantage of automated parking systems is the convenience they offer to drivers. No longer do drivers have to search for an available parking space or waste time maneuvering their vehicle into tight spots. With automated parking systems, drivers can simply drop off their vehicle at the entrance of the facility and let the system take care of the rest. This not only saves time and reduces stress for drivers, but it also helps to alleviate traffic congestion in busy urban areas by streamlining the parking process.

Furthermore, automated parking systems are environmentally friendly solutions to traditional parking structures. By utilizing vertical stacking and efficient storage methods, automated parking systems reduce the need for large, sprawling parking lots that eat up valuable green space. Additionally, the automated nature of these systems means that vehicles are parked in a more orderly and efficient manner, reducing emissions from idling cars and improving air quality in urban areas.

As with any new technology, there are some challenges and considerations to be taken into account when implementing automated parking systems. The initial cost of installing an automated parking system can be high, making it a significant investment for property owners and developers. However, proponents of automated parking systems argue that the long-term benefits in terms of space efficiency, security, and convenience outweigh the upfront costs.

Additionally, there may be concerns about the reliability and maintenance of automated parking systems. Like any mechanical system, automated parking systems require regular maintenance and upkeep to ensure smooth operation. However, with proper maintenance and monitoring, automated parking systems can provide a reliable and efficient parking solution for years to come.
